Hi Alex, I hope you enjoyed the holidays!
We're trying to upstream idef-parser (the automatic generator of the
Hexagon frontend). This introduces new dependencies, specifically flex
and bison.
Attached you can find our patch for that.
However the CI fails:
https://gitlab.com/carl.cudig/qemu/-/jobs/1939950230
AFAIU the Hexagon docker image is "special" since it's the only one
that needs the cross-compiler to be built from source and, therefore,
it's a process that needs to be triggered manually.
Is this correct?
If so, what should we do? Make a pull request despite the failure and
then it will be taken care of, or should I make a separate (preliminary)
pull request just for that patch?
